MobileNets:为移动和嵌入式设备设计的轻量级神经网络
2024.02.18 16:53浏览量:69简介:MobileNets是针对移动和嵌入式设备设计的轻量级神经网络,通过深度可分离卷积和两个超参数实现了高效的资源与精度之间的平衡。本文将详细解析MobileNets的工作原理和特点,并探讨其在不同应用场景中的表现。
随着深度学习在计算机视觉领域的广泛应用,对高效模型的追求已成为一个迫切的需求。特别是在移动和嵌入式设备上,由于计算资源和能源的限制,模型的轻量级和高效性变得尤为重要。MobileNets正是在这样的背景下诞生的。MobileNets是一种基于深度可分离卷积的高效神经网络,旨在为移动和嵌入式设备提供卓越的视觉处理能力。MobileNets的核心思想是通过深度可分离卷积来减少计算量和模型参数,从而实现更快的推理速度和更小的模型大小。这种卷积方式已在Inception模型中得到应用,并在MobileNets中得到了进一步的发展。在MobileNets中,除了深度可分离卷积外,还引入了两个简单的全局超参数来平衡延迟和准确度。这些超参数允许模型构建者根据实际应用的需求选择合适大小的模型。MobileNets的提出对于移动和嵌入式设备来说具有重要意义。随着智能设备的普及,人们对设备性能、电池寿命和计算效率的要求越来越高。MobileNets作为一种轻量级的神经网络,能够在满足这些要求的同时提供出色的视觉处理能力。MobileNets适用于各种应用场景,如物体检测、细粒度分类、人脸属性识别和大规模地理定位等。在实践中,MobileNets已被证明在资源有限的环境中具有优越的性能。相比于其他流行的网络模型,MobileNets在保持较高精度的同时,显著降低了计算量和模型大小,从而提高了运行速度和能效比。
要了解MobileNets的更多细节,我们可以深入探讨其核心组件——深度可分离卷积。深度可分离卷积是一种特殊的卷积方式,它将标准卷积分解为两个独立的操作:深度卷积和点卷积。深度卷积关注于空间维度上的特征提取,而点卷积则关注于通道维度上的特征组合。这种分解使得深度可分离卷积在计算量和模型参数上都比标准卷积更具优势。在MobileNets中,深度级可分离卷积被用作基本单元,进一步减少了模型的复杂度。此外,MobileNets还通过引入两个超参数来平衡准确度和延迟度。这些超参数允许模型构建者根据实际需求调整模型大小和性能,从而实现最佳的资源利用效果。
在实际应用中,MobileNets已被广泛用于各种计算机视觉任务。例如,在物体检测中,MobileNets能够快速准确地识别出图像中的目标物体;在细粒度分类中,MobileNets能够区分出不同物种或物品的细微差别;在人脸属性识别中,MobileNets能够分析出人脸的各种特征;在大规模地理定位中,MobileNets能够快速准确地定位目标地点。这些应用场景证明了MobileNets在移动和嵌入式设备上的强大功能和广泛应用前景。
总结起来,MobileNets是一种专为移动和嵌入式设备设计的轻量级神经网络。它通过深度可分离卷积和两个超参数实现了高效的资源与精度之间的平衡,为各种应用场景提供了强大的视觉处理能力。随着智能设备的普及和深度学习的发展,MobileNets将在未来的计算机视觉领域发挥越来越重要的作用。无论是初学者还是专业人士,理解和应用MobileNets都将有助于更好地解决计算机视觉领域的实际问题。

发表评论
登录后可评论,请前往 登录 或 注册